2# Physical Layer USB driver configuration
3#
4menu "USB Physical Layer drivers"
5
6config USB_PHY
7 def_bool n
8
9#
10# USB Transceiver Drivers
11#
12config AB8500_USB
13 tristate "AB8500 USB Transceiver Driver"
14 depends on AB8500_CORE
15 select USB_PHY
16 help
17 Enable this to support the USB OTG transceiver in AB8500 chip.
18 This transceiver supports high and full speed devices plus,
19 in host mode, low speed.
20
21config FSL_USB2_OTG
22 bool "Freescale USB OTG Transceiver Driver"
23 depends on USB_EHCI_FSL && USB_FSL_USB2 && USB_OTG_FSM && PM
24 select USB_PHY
25 help
26 Enable this to support Freescale USB OTG transceiver.
27
28config ISP1301_OMAP
29 tristate "Philips ISP1301 with OMAP OTG"
30 depends on I2C && ARCH_OMAP_OTG
31 depends on USB
32 select USB_PHY
33 help
34 If you say yes here you get support for the Philips ISP1301
35 USB-On-The-Go transceiver working with the OMAP OTG controller.
36 The ISP1301 is a full speed USB transceiver which is used in
37 products including H2, H3, and H4 development boards for Texas
38 Instruments OMAP processors.
39
40 This driver can also be built as a module. If so, the module
41 will be called phy-isp1301-omap.
42
43config KEYSTONE_USB_PHY
44 tristate "Keystone USB PHY Driver"
45 depends on ARCH_KEYSTONE || COMPILE_TEST
46 select NOP_USB_XCEIV
47 help
48 Enable this to support Keystone USB phy. This driver provides
49 interface to interact with USB 2.0 and USB 3.0 PHY that is part
50 of the Keystone SOC.
51
52config NOP_USB_XCEIV
53 tristate "NOP USB Transceiver Driver"
54 select USB_PHY
55 help
56 This driver is to be used by all the usb transceiver which are either
57 built-in with usb ip or which are autonomous and doesn't require any
58 phy programming such as ISP1x04 etc.
59
60config AM335X_CONTROL_USB
61 tristate
62
63config AM335X_PHY_USB
64 tristate "AM335x USB PHY Driver"
65 depends on ARM || COMPILE_TEST
66 select USB_PHY
67 select AM335X_CONTROL_USB
68 select NOP_USB_XCEIV
69 select USB_COMMON
70 help
71 This driver provides PHY support for that phy which part for the
72 AM335x SoC.
73
74config SAMSUNG_USBPHY
75 tristate
76 help
77 Enable this to support Samsung USB phy helper driver for Samsung SoCs.
78 This driver provides common interface to interact, for Samsung USB 2.0 PHY
79 driver and later for Samsung USB 3.0 PHY driver.
80
81config TWL6030_USB
82 tristate "TWL6030 USB Transceiver Driver"
83 depends on TWL4030_CORE && OMAP_USB2 && USB_MUSB_OMAP2PLUS
84 help
85 Enable this to support the USB OTG transceiver on TWL6030
86 family chips. This TWL6030 transceiver has the VBUS and ID GND
87 and OTG SRP events capabilities. For all other transceiver functionality
88 UTMI PHY is embedded in OMAP4430. The internal PHY configurations APIs
89 are hooked to this driver through platform_data structure.
90 The definition of internal PHY APIs are in the mach-omap2 layer.
91
92config USB_GPIO_VBUS
93 tristate "GPIO based peripheral-only VBUS sensing 'transceiver'"
94 depends on GPIOLIB || COMPILE_TEST
95 select USB_PHY
96 help
97 Provides simple GPIO VBUS sensing for controllers with an
98 internal transceiver via the usb_phy interface, and
99 optionally control of a D+ pullup GPIO as well as a VBUS
100 current limit regulator.
101
102config OMAP_OTG
103 tristate "OMAP USB OTG controller driver"
104 depends on ARCH_OMAP_OTG && EXTCON
105 help
106 Enable this to support some transceivers on OMAP1 platforms. OTG
107 controller is needed to switch between host and peripheral modes.
108
109 This driver can also be built as a module. If so, the module
110 will be called phy-omap-otg.
111
112config TAHVO_USB
113 tristate "Tahvo USB transceiver driver"
114 depends on MFD_RETU && EXTCON
115 select USB_PHY
116 help
117 Enable this to support USB transceiver on Tahvo. This is used
118 at least on Nokia 770.
119
120config TAHVO_USB_HOST_BY_DEFAULT
121 depends on TAHVO_USB
122 bool "Device in USB host mode by default"
123 help
124 Say Y here, if you want the device to enter USB host mode
125 by default on bootup.
126
127config USB_ISP1301
128 tristate "NXP ISP1301 USB transceiver support"
129 depends on USB || USB_GADGET
130 depends on I2C
131 select USB_PHY
132 help
133 Say Y here to add support for the NXP ISP1301 USB transceiver driver.
134 This chip is typically used as USB transceiver for USB host, gadget
135 and OTG drivers (to be selected separately).
136
137 To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
138 module will be called phy-isp1301.
139
140config USB_MSM_OTG
141 tristate "Qualcomm on-chip USB OTG controller support"
142 depends on (USB || USB_GADGET) && (ARCH_QCOM || COMPILE_TEST)
143 depends on RESET_CONTROLLER
144 depends on EXTCON
145 select USB_PHY
146 help
147 Enable this to support the USB OTG transceiver on Qualcomm chips. It
148 handles PHY initialization, clock management, and workarounds
149 required after resetting the hardware and power management.
150 This driver is required even for peripheral only or host only
151 mode configurations.
152 This driver is not supported on boards like trout which
153 has an external PHY.
154
155config USB_QCOM_8X16_PHY
156 tristate "Qualcomm APQ8016/MSM8916 on-chip USB PHY controller support"
157 depends on ARCH_QCOM || COMPILE_TEST
158 depends on RESET_CONTROLLER && EXTCON
159 select USB_PHY
160 select USB_ULPI_VIEWPORT
161 help
162 Enable this to support the USB transceiver on Qualcomm 8x16 chipsets.
163 It handles PHY initialization, clock management, power management,
164 and workarounds required after resetting the hardware.
165
166 To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
167 module will be called phy-qcom-8x16-usb.
168
169config USB_MV_OTG
170 tristate "Marvell USB OTG support"
171 depends on USB_EHCI_MV && USB_MV_UDC && PM && USB_OTG
172 select USB_PHY
173 help
174 Say Y here if you want to build Marvell USB OTG transciever
175 driver in kernel (including PXA and MMP series). This driver
176 implements role switch between EHCI host driver and gadget driver.
177
178 To compile this driver as a module, choose M here.
179
180config USB_MXS_PHY
181 tristate "Freescale MXS USB PHY support"
182 depends on ARCH_MXC || ARCH_MXS
183 select STMP_DEVICE
184 select USB_PHY
185 help
186 Enable this to support the Freescale MXS USB PHY.
187
188 MXS Phy is used by some of the i.MX SoCs, for example imx23/28/6x.
189
190config USB_ULPI
191 bool "Generic ULPI Transceiver Driver"
192 depends on ARM || ARM64
193 select USB_ULPI_VIEWPORT
194 help
195 Enable this to support ULPI connected USB OTG transceivers which
196 are likely found on embedded boards.
197
198config USB_ULPI_VIEWPORT
199 bool
200 help
201 Provides read/write operations to the ULPI phy register set for
202 controllers with a viewport register (e.g. Chipidea/ARC controllers).
203
204endmenu
